Chinese AI startup DeepSeek is set to release a new artificial intelligence model, marking a direct challenge to US technology leaders. The company has been developing this long-awaited system in collaboration with Huawei, aiming to reduce dependence on Nvidia chips. This move signals growing technological independence in China's AI sector.

DeepSeek's partnership with Huawei represents a strategic shift away from US semiconductor dominance. By working with Huawei's Ascend AI processors, DeepSeek is building capabilities that could operate independently of American technology. This development comes amid escalating trade tensions and export controls that have limited China's access to advanced Nvidia chips.

The timing of DeepSeek's launch is significant as US companies like OpenAI, Google, and Anthropic continue to dominate global AI development. China's push for technological self-reliance has accelerated since Washington imposed restrictions on semiconductor exports. DeepSeek's new model could demonstrate whether Chinese AI firms can compete at the cutting edge without relying on American hardware.
